18 lines
602 B
Python
18 lines
602 B
Python
from faker import Faker
|
|
from random import randint
|
|
import csv
|
|
|
|
fake_data = Faker("pl_PL")
|
|
|
|
|
|
with open("dane_big.csv", "w", newline="") as plik_csv:
|
|
dane_writer = csv.writer(plik_csv, delimiter=",", \
|
|
quotechar='"', quoting=csv.QUOTE_NONNUMERIC)
|
|
for _ in range(100000):
|
|
wiersz = []
|
|
wiersz.append(fake_data.name())
|
|
wiersz.append(randint(10,6000))
|
|
wiersz.append(fake_data.credit_card_number())
|
|
wiersz.append(fake_data.company())
|
|
wiersz.append(fake_data.address().replace('\n',' ~ '))
|
|
dane_writer.writerow(wiersz) |